Key Lesson #1: There's no such thing as having a bad day, only our (present) inability to see the Good in it. Doing the right thing, in the right way, begins with seeing the right order of things. All of life's lessons point us toward this simple, celestial truth. Through the pain of missteps and mistakes, we are gradually awakened to discover what has always been right before our eyes: Whenever things are out of order within us, our choices and actions must follow-- and sorrow is the inevitable result. Key Lesson #2: Only Love heals. All other ambitions -- to free ourselves, to secure some form of imagined peace -- are the work of an unseen, deeply conflicted level of self, forever searching for, but never finding what only Love can grant: wholeness.

but our reaction to a sensation not the sensation but our reaction to it and they're two totally different things listen to this I have to go through it quickly you come back and hear it sensations like I'm warm right now are raw sensory data that's what a sensation is it's a form of data it is engaging and giving me a direct experience of what I am in around and moving through me sensation is simple reactions on the other hand are a way in which this nature interprets and acts on that data that's what a reaction is it is something in us that has us and that looks at a sensation and that wants to know it brings out of its condition past what it knows about that sensation which it's already lived a hundred thousand times and it says ah I know what that is for example this is for me personal a toothache or maybe the onset of a cold sore oh god what oh no not again oh no now why would I here I'm being given a sensation by my own body and my own body is saying guy there's a problem and you should attend to it now you have to agree that when a sensation of a pain is pointing to this the pain in the body it's saying were you I need you involved in this I can handle a lot of it but you have a part in this too so we can understand that a toothache is a helpful indication of an infection of some kind now if you can agree with that which it is true how does that helpful indication that my body is saying a guy pay attention how does that turn into a pain psychologically negative experience because it does it goes from the awareness the sensation of a toothache into the hatred of the dentist the fear of the cost a hundred thousand different ways in which now I'm I'm on the ride that Josh was on I'm being stimulated by what not the sensation I'm being stimulated by my own reaction to it and every reaction is already conflicted so now I'm filled with all kinds of subsequent thoughts and feelings trying to tell me how to change the condition blamed for the sensation instead of simply recognizing that this moment the difference between how should I say here's the difference between sensation and reaction here's the difference between sensation and reaction I hope this is interesting to you I tell you one day it'll have to be if you ever want to be free sensation is the as I said the initial automatic detection of stimulus by the body's sensory organs I see I hear I smell I taste while a reaction is a subsequent emotional mental or behavioral response to that sensation say it again sensation is the initial detection the relationship between myself and the environment and the sensation in and of itself has no quality other than to point out that there is something transpiring between myself and my environment whereas the reaction is what follows the registration of that sensation and now there's some obvious emotional mental or behavioral response and it's only as we begin to realize you know I need to look a little more deeply into this subject or do I want to spend my life going to bed arguing with someone because I was something stimulated that event earlier and now I'm reliving it and the sensation of reliving the negative experience fills me with more negativity and I blame the sensation I'm having on the memory on the condition when the condition is not producing that only as we learn to look deeply into this difference between our sensations and the mind's reaction to them where what all sensations don't have want and not want in them please if I put my hand accidentally in hot water the body isn't negative that I did that the body is aware of a sensation that's saying this is hurting you withdraw your hand but no more do I do naturally what the sensation is indicating which is completing a cycle then I'm calling myself stupid then I'm hating the pot or someone else who didn't tell me they did this or the other all the time so sensations don't have want and not want in them no sensation has want or not want want and not want belong to an identity a structured sense of self that's always measuring the event depending on how it falls into its conditioned memories so only as we recognize this reaction as the source
